This simple practice can have a significant impact on your overall health and well-being.<\/span><\/p><h5><strong>Mechanisms of Dehydration<\/strong><\/h5><ol><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Fluid Loss<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">:<\/span><ul><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><b>Sweating<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">: This is a primary method of fluid loss, especially during exercise or exposure to high temperatures. Sweat helps cool the body but also depletes water and electrolytes.<\/span><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><b>Respiration<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">: Water is lost through breathing, especially in dry, cold conditions.<\/span><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><b>Urination and Defecation<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">: The kidneys excrete waste products in urine, and the intestines absorb and excrete water in feces.<\/span><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><b>Illness<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">: Vomiting and diarrhea can cause significant fluid loss, leading to dehydration.<\/span><\/li><\/ul><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Fluid Intake<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">:<\/span><ul><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Inadequate fluid intake, either through drinking water or consuming water-rich foods, can lead to dehydration if it does not meet the body\u2019s needs.<\/span><\/li><\/ul><\/li><\/ol><h5><strong>Physiological Effects of Dehydration<\/strong><\/h5><ol><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Cellular Function<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">:<\/span><ul><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Cells rely on water to transport nutrients and remove waste. Dehydration hampers these processes, impairing cell function and overall metabolism.<\/span><\/li><\/ul><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Blood Volume and Circulation<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">:<\/span><ul><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Dehydration reduces blood volume, leading to decreased blood pressure and impaired circulation. This affects the delivery of oxygen and nutrients to tissues.<\/span><\/li><\/ul><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Electrolyte Imbalance<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">:<\/span><ul><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Electrolytes (such as sodium, potassium, and chloride) are crucial for muscle function, nerve transmission, and hydration balance. Dehydration disrupts electrolyte levels, leading to muscle cramps, weakness, and arrhythmias.<\/span><\/li><\/ul><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Thermoregulation<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">:<\/span><ul><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Water is essential for maintaining body temperature. Dehydration impairs the body\u2019s ability to sweat and cool itself, increasing the risk of heat-related illnesses like heat exhaustion and heat stroke.<\/span><\/li><\/ul><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Cognitive Function<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">:<\/span><ul><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Dehydration affects brain function, leading to symptoms like confusion, irritability, and impaired cognitive performance.<\/span><\/li><\/ul><\/li><\/ol><h5><strong>Symptoms of Dehydration<\/strong><\/h5><ol><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Mild to Moderate Dehydration<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">:<\/span><ul><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Thirst<\/span><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Dry mouth and skin<\/span><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Dark yellow urine<\/span><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Fatigue and dizziness<\/span><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Headache<\/span><\/li><\/ul><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Severe Dehydration<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">:<\/span><ul><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Very dry skin and mucous membranes<\/span><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Rapid heartbeat and breathing<\/span><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Sunken eyes<\/span><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Low blood pressure<\/span><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Severe muscle cramps<\/span><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Confusion and lethargy<\/span><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Unconsciousness<\/span><\/li><\/ul><\/li><\/ol><h5><strong>Diagnosis and Measurement<\/strong><\/h5><ol><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Clinical Assessment<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">:<\/span><ul><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Evaluation of symptoms, medical history, and physical examination.<\/span><\/li><\/ul><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Laboratory Tests<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">:<\/span><ul><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Blood tests to assess electrolyte levels, kidney function, and blood concentration (hematocrit).<\/span><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Urine tests to evaluate specific gravity and osmolality, indicating hydration status.<\/span><\/li><\/ul><\/li><\/ol><h5><strong>Prevention and Treatment<\/strong><\/h5><ol><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Hydration Strategies<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">:<\/span><ul><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Drink plenty of fluids, particularly water, throughout the day.<\/span><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Consume water-rich foods such as fruits and vegetables.<\/span><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Monitor urine color as a simple gauge of hydration status\u2014pale yellow is typically a sign of adequate hydration.<\/span><\/li><\/ul><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Electrolyte Replenishment<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">:<\/span><ul><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">In cases of significant fluid loss (e.g., sweating, diarrhea), oral rehydration solutions or sports drinks containing electrolytes can help restore balance.<\/span><\/li><\/ul><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Medical Intervention<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">:<\/span><ul><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Severe dehydration may require intravenous (IV) fluids to rapidly restore fluid and electrolyte balance.<\/span><\/li><\/ul><\/li><\/ol><h5><strong>Special Considerations<\/strong><\/h5><ol><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Children and the Elderly<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">:<\/span><ul><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">These populations are at higher risk for dehydration due to differences in fluid regulation and a reduced ability to recognize thirst. Careful monitoring and encouragement to drink fluids are essential.<\/span><\/li><\/ul><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Athletes and Active Individuals<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">:<\/span><ul><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Increased physical activity raises fluid requirements. It\u2019s important to hydrate before, during, and after exercise to maintain performance and prevent dehydration.<\/span><\/li><\/ul><\/li><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Environmental Factors<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">:<\/span><ul><li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"2\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Hot and humid conditions increase sweat loss. People living or working in these environments need to increase their fluid intake to compensate.<\/span><\/li><\/ul><\/li><\/ol><p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Dehydration is a condition that can significantly impact physical and cognitive performance, and in severe cases, it can be life-threatening.
